ATM

132 3rd St
Turners Falls, MA 01376

The automatic teller machine (ATM) located in Turners Falls, MA, offers convenient access to cash and banking services for residents and visitors. Positioned in a well-trafficked area, it ensures easy usability with clear instructions and security features. This ATM is a reliable option for quick transactions, making it a valuable resource for the local community.

Generated from this place's information

Own this business?
See a problem?

You might also like

Partial Data by Infogroup (c) 2025. All rights reserved.

Partial Data by Foursquare.